Generally, a debtor may demand a receipt for payment of an obligation. No particular form is necessary for a valid receipt. However, a receipt should recite all facts necessary to substantiate the tender and acceptance of payment.

Description: A Wake North Carolina Receipt for Payment of Salary or Wages is an official document provided to employees as proof of their earnings from an employer based in Wake County, North Carolina. This receipt serves as a record of payment received and includes important details about the transaction. The receipt typically includes the following relevant information: 1. Date: The date when the payment is made. 2. Employee Information: Name, designation, employee identification number, and contact details. 3. Employer Information: Company name, address, and contact information. 4. Payment Period: The specific period for which the payment is being made (e.g., weekly, bi-weekly, monthly). 5. Gross Salary/Wages: The total amount earned by the employee before any deductions. 6. Deductions: Any deductions made from the gross amount, such as taxes, insurance premiums, contributions to retirement plans, or other authorized withholding. 7. Net Salary/Wages: The final amount left after subtracting the deductions from the gross salary/wages. 8. Payment Method: The mode of payment, such as direct deposit, paper check, or electronic transfer. 9. Signature: Signature of the employee, confirming the receipt of payment. Different types of Wake North Carolina Receipts for Payment of Salary or Wages may include: 1. Regular Salary Receipt: A receipt provided to employees who receive a fixed salary for their services under an employment contract. 2. Hourly Wages Receipt: Given to employees who are paid an hourly rate for the number of hours worked during a specified payment period. 3. Overtime Wages Receipt: Provided if an employee receives additional payment for working beyond their regular hours, often at a higher rate. 4. Commission Wages Receipt: Issued to employees who earn a percentage or fixed amount based on their sales performance. 5. Bonus Payment Receipt: A receipt given to employees for any additional compensation apart from their regular salary/wages, such as performance bonuses or holiday bonuses. 6. Severance Pay Receipt: When an employee is terminated or laid off, this receipt confirms the payment made by the employer as part of a severance package. 7. Payroll Advance Receipt: Provided if an employee receives an advance payment against future earnings, which is deducted from subsequent paychecks until the advance is fully repaid.
